1Pcs 8318120040 LX450 Speed Sensor Car Auto Part fit for Toyota Land Cruiser 8318120040 Lexus ​Car Accessories

1Pcs 8318120040 LX450 Speed Sensor Car Auto Part fit for Toyota Land Cruiser 8318120040 Lexus ​Car Accessories
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005005020471504
$4.96
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ed